indoors Arrival Story: We went to the shelter on the grounds that I would be getting a girl cat. Kitten, adult, didn't matter - as long as the cat was female. As we walked up to the shelter I could see a beautiful orange tabby cat sitting in a window cage of their front room. Excited, I decided then and there THAT was the cat I wanted - there was just something about how confident he sat there, as if he was on top of the world! My mother told me we would walk through the shelter first because I might see another cat I'd like, and so we did. The entire time my thoughts kept going back to that beautiful tabby in the window though, and after walking through the place my mother finally let me go meet the tabby. When we found out the cat was a male, I was crushed..my mother had said no males, and that was final..or so I thought. He shared the cage with his other siblings, two beautiful kittens - one black male, one blue female. My brother was with us that day, and each of us got to hold a kitten, when it was my turn to hold the orange tabby and he snuggled up to me I just knew at that very moment that he WAS the one I wanted, even if he was a male. So that day, I went home with him. Bio: Milo was a crazy cat as a kitten, which is why he's named Milo..after the Milo in Milo & Otis! I remember him tearing through his cage at the shelter, terrorizing his siblings and knocking everything over. He was spunky, and I loved it! He stayed that crazy kitten for a long time before my grandparents taking Mama Kitty crushed him. He's still that wild kitten when he wants to be, but now he's also my grumpy old man. Milo is a large cat, not fat, just tall. He's also a softy, and has never bit or clawed me out of annoyance, and despite how much Aimi drives him insane, he's a big softy to her too.
